- Title
Detection of Oddity using User Behavior Patterns and Home Conditions for Home Automation of IOT Devices.
- Authors
Vimal, V. R.; Vineetha, Bijjam; Dinusha, Chandra; Madhuri, Mummadi Venkata Naga
- Abstract
In this today's generation, Everyone is using electrical appliances in our homes such as refrigerator, Air Conditioner etc... For security purpose all these were connected to internet. Cyber attacksis one of the main problem in these days. These appliances are targets of cyber attacks which cause harm to users as well as it also a problem in compromising safety. The attacks include volume up air conditioners, automatic operations etc... To overcome this problem we deal with Anomaly Detection. We have proposed a model for detecting such abnormal conditions based on user Behavior patterns. As this is already exists only for single user by using Hidden Markov Model[HMM]. This is an evaluation of HMM model. Smart home consists of multiple users we will be implementing this proposed method even in case on multiple users. This method mainly based on user condition sequences as well of home conditions such as temperature and time. This method obtained detection ratios exceeding 90% anomalous operations with less than10% of misdirection when our method observed event sequences related to operations.
